Supreme: You Already Know
Supreme never explains itself, so this campaign doesn't either. It treats wanting the brand as a form of status, daring the luxury crossover audience to keep up instead of inviting them in.
Supreme has spent three decades building the most imitated brand in fashion without ever explaining itself. It drops, sells out, and moves on. But a new audience is circling. The luxury crossover crowd that shops Ssense and Dover Street Market is drawn to the prestige yet uncertain of the ritual. They want in, but they watch from a distance.
"You Already Know" is a statement of fact that doubles as a challenge. A nod to the people who get it, an itch for the people who don't. No product, no explanation, no URL. Just a red box logo on black, a sticker found in the wild, and an empty pedestal that reads "the drop was yesterday." The restraint is the message.
